...A SEVERE THUNDERSTORM WARNING REMAINS IN EFFECT UNTIL 1030 PM CDT
FOR CENTRAL SEMINOLE AND NORTHWESTERN HUGHES COUNTIES...

At 1022 PM CDT, a severe thunderstorm was located 6 miles northwest
of Wewoka, moving southeast at 40 mph.

HAZARD...60 mph wind gusts and quarter size hail.

SOURCE...Radar indicated.

IMPACT...Hail damage to vehicles is expected. Expect wind damage to
         roofs, siding, and trees.

Locations impacted include...
Seminole, Holdenville, Wewoka, Bowlegs, Yeager, and Lima.

PRECAUTIONARY/PREPAREDNESS ACTIONS...

For your protection move to an interior room on the lowest floor of a
building.
